Monocrystalline solar panels have black-colored solar cells made of a single silicon crystal and usually have a higher efficiency rating. Polycrystalline solar panels have blue-colored cells made of multiple silicon crystals melted. . When you evaluate solar panels for your photovoltaic (PV) system, you'll encounter two main categories of panels: monocrystalline solar panels (mono) and polycrystalline solar panels (poly). Both types produce energy from the sun, but there are some key differences to be aware of. Most homeowners. .
